Aurora is a suburb of Chicago located in Kane County and Dupage County with some portions in Kendall and Will Counties. Aurora is the second most populous city in Illinois, according to the 2013 census, the population was 199,963 people. Aurora's downtown is located on the Fox River and it officially adopted the nickname "City of Lights" because it was one of the first cities in the US to implement an all electric street lighting system in 1881.
